Honeydew in print

It is pale enough that on uncoated stock it can read even lighter than on screen. The cmyk build is 2, 0, 3, 5.

The same color needs a different cmyk build depending on the paper. Here is #edf2ea on both.

Coated stockgloss or silk, C
2 0 3 5
Ink sits on the surface, so colors stay bright and close to screen.
Uncoated stocknatural or matte, U
6 4 7 11
The stock absorbs ink and gains dot, so it needs a heavier build and reads a touch softer.

This color converts to cmyk comfortably and should hold on press.

How we calculate these values

Every value on this page for #edf2ea is computed, not guessed. We convert from sRGB to each space with the standard formulas, so the codes match what design tools show. The uncoated cmyk build carries more ink than the coated one, which is what a printer would compensate for when the same color runs on a rougher stock. The Pantone value is the closest reference by perceptual color distance and should be treated as a starting point, not a guaranteed match.
